Using Humor to Find the Success in Uncertainty
With Special Guest: Joel Zeff, Work Culture Expert, Keynote Speaker & Author
Uncertainty is serious business. But the leaders who navigate it best may have one thing in common: they never stopped having fun.
In this episode, Meridith sits down with Joel Zeff — work culture expert, improv performer, and author of Make the Right Choice — to make the case that laughter is not a soft skill. It is a competitive advantage hiding in plain sight.
Joel has spent 25-plus years turning corporate audiences into improv performers and proving that the same instincts that make a great improv scene — listening, adapting, supporting your team, saying yes — are exactly the instincts that make a great leader.
